精河6.6级地震前精河水管仪、伸缩仪异常特征分析

摘    要:2017年8月9日精河发生6.6级地震。本文首先利用相关、回归分析研究了气温对水管仪、伸缩仪的影响,并进行了干扰的定量剔除;其次,通过回归残差分析研究地震前水管仪、伸缩仪的异常特征,认为精河6.6级地震前存在3项异常:①2016年5月22日起,水管仪NS分量S倾幅度0.53";②2017年3月24日起,EW分量E倾幅度0.28";③2016年9月10日起,伸缩仪NS分量出现压缩现象。

Analysis of Anomalous Characteristics of Jinghe Water Tube Tilt and Extensometer Temperature before the Jinghe MS 6.6 Earthquake

Abstract:The MS 6.6 earthquake occurred on August 9, 2017 in Jinghe. In order to investigate the anomaly characteristics from water tube tiltmeter and extensometer in Jinghe station, we analyzed the effects of air temperature on water tube tiltmeter and extensometer in Jinghe by using the correlation and regression analysis then rejected the interference of air temperature quantitatively. The analysis of regression residuals shows that there existed three abnormalities before the earthquake: ① S tilt amplitude 0.53" in NS component from water tube tiltmeter since May 22, 2016; ② EW component tilt amplitude 0.28" from March 24, 2017; ③From September 10, 2016, the NS component of the telescopic instrument appears to be compressed.
